A community showed up for our family. Now we show up for others.
In 2014, Zac and Samantha Czerniewski welcomed their daughter Paislee Jo into the world. She was born with CHARGE Syndrome and spent her first three months in the NICU.
What carried their family through wasn't just medical care. It was people. Neighbors, friends, and strangers who showed up, gave generously, and refused to let them carry it alone.
Paislee Jo kept surprising everyone. Her spirit, her determination, and her joy for life became the reason for something bigger.
PJs People was built on one simple belief: no family should have to walk this road without a community behind them.
PJs People is still run by the same people who started it. Our board is our family. This work is personal to every one of us.
